Removal
REMOVAL
PROCEDURE
1. REMOVE DRIVE MONITOR SWITCH
2. REMOVE MAP LIGHT ASSEMBLY
3. REMOVE TELEPHONE MICROPHONE ASSEMBLY
|
(a) Disconnect the 6 connectors. |
|
|
(b) Remove the screw. |
|
|
(c) Detach the 8 claws and remove the inner bezel. |
|
|
(d) Disconnect the connector. |
|
(e) Detach the 2 claws and remove the telephone microphone.
4. REMOVE AMPLIFIER MICROPHONE ASSEMBLY
|
(a) Disconnect the connector and remove the amplifier microphone. |

Installation
INSTALLATION
PROCEDURE
1. INSTALL AMPLIFIER MICROPHONE ASSEMBLY
(a) Connect the connector and install the amplifier microphone.
2. INSTALL TELEPHONE MICROPHONE ASSEMBLY
(a) Attach the 2 claws to install the telephone microphone.
(b) Connect the connector.
(c) Attach the 8 claws to install the inner bezel.
(d) Install the screw.
(e) Connect the 6 connectors.
3. INSTALL MAP LIGHT ASSEMBLY
4. INSTALL DRIVE MONITOR SWITCH
